Venator's Draught

Drinks
Historic

Mentioned in Izaak Walton's 'The Compleat Angler' (1653) as "a drink composed of sack, milk, oranges, and sugar, which, all put together, make a drink like nectar indeed; and too good for anybody, but us anglers."
